The thyroid is a small but powerful gland located at the front of the neck, playing a crucial role in regulating metabolism, energy levels, and overall bodily functions. When the thyroid is not functioning properly, it can cause a variety of symptoms that affect health and well-being. Hypothyroidism: An Underactive Thyroid:Hypothyroidism occurs when the thyroid gland does not secrete sufficient levels of thyroid hormones, mainly thyroxine (T4) and triiodothyronine (T3). Overview of Pituitary Hormone Disorders:Disorders of the pituitary gland result from the gland's excessive or insufficient production of a particular hormone. Such imbalances are brought about by tumors, genetics, infections, head injuries, or autoimmune disorders. What is Cushing's Syndrome?Cushing's syndrome is a hormonal disorder resulting from chronic exposure to excess cortisol levels. The condition can occur through endogenous causes, including an overactive adrenal gland or pituitary tumor (Cushing's disease) or exogenous sources, mostly from chronic corticosteroid medication. Thyroid cancer, although relatively rare in comparison to other cancers, has been increasing in incidence over the past few decades. It originates from the thyroid gland, an important endocrine organ that controls metabolism by producing hormones. Most thyroid cancers are slow-growing and easily curable, but some aggressive forms need specialised treatment.
